1. Using Fax Software
Many computers come equipped with fax software, especially if you’re using Windows. This method requires a modem, which allows your computer to send faxes over a phone line.
Steps to Fax Using Windows Fax and Scan
- Set Up the Fax Modem:
- Ensure your modem is connected to the telephone line.
-
Install any necessary drivers if prompted.
-
Open Windows Fax and Scan:
- Search for “Windows Fax and Scan” in the Start menu.
-
Click on “New Fax” to start the process.
-
Compose Your Fax:
- Enter the recipient’s fax number.
- Attach the documents you wish to send.
-
Include a cover page if necessary.
-
Send the Fax:
- Review the details and click “Send.”
- Wait for confirmation that the fax has been sent successfully.
2. Online Fax Services
Online fax services have gained popularity due to their convenience and accessibility. These services allow you to send and receive faxes via the internet.
How to Use an Online Fax Service
- Choose a Service:
- Select a reputable online fax service (e.g., eFax, RingCentral).
-
Sign up for an account, which may require a subscription.
-
Upload Your Document:
- Log into your account and select the option to send a fax.
-
Upload the document you want to fax from your computer.
-
Enter the Fax Number:
-
Input the recipient’s fax number and any cover page details.
-
Send the Fax:
- Review the information and click “Send.”
- Most services will provide you with a confirmation email or notification once the fax is sent.

Benefits of Faxing from a Computer
Faxing from a computer offers several advantages:
- Convenience: Send faxes from anywhere with an internet connection.
- Cost-Effective: Reduce costs associated with traditional fax machines and paper.
- Efficiency: Quickly send documents without needing to visit a physical fax machine.
- Easy Document Management: Store and organize faxes digitally for easy access and retrieval.
Challenges of Faxing from a Computer
While there are many benefits, there are also some challenges to consider:
- Reliability: Online services may experience downtime or technical issues.
- Privacy Concerns: Ensure that the online service you use has robust security measures.
- Compatibility: Some older documents or formats may not transmit properly.
Practical Tips for Successful Faxing
Here are some tips to ensure your faxing process goes smoothly:
- Check Fax Number: Always double-check the recipient’s fax number to avoid sending sensitive information to the wrong person.
- Use Clear Formatting: Make sure your documents are well-formatted and easy to read.
- Include a Cover Page: Adding a cover page can help clarify the purpose of your fax.
- Keep Records: Maintain a record of sent faxes for your personal reference.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
Can I fax from my laptop without a phone line?
Yes, you can use online fax services, which allow you to fax documents over the internet without needing a phone line.
Is it safe to send sensitive information via fax?
While faxing is generally more secure than email, it’s essential to use reputable services that offer encryption and other security measures.
What file formats can I send via online fax services?
Most online fax services accept common file formats like PDF, DOC, and JPG. Check with your chosen service for specific supported formats.
Do I need a subscription to use online fax services?
Many online fax services require a subscription, but some offer pay-per-use options. Choose a plan that fits your needs.
How can I receive faxes on my computer?
To receive faxes on your computer, you can use an online fax service that provides a dedicated fax number. Incoming faxes will be sent directly to your email or service account.
